Question:
Do birds really eat peanuts?
P P
2008-03-13 04:03:33 UTC
I feed birds in the garden with various things -- but none actually eat the peanuts. I have even mixed the peanuts with sunflour seeds, and the birds just pull the sunflower seeds out leaving the peanuts... The other day, I was talking to someone and they said the found just the same...

Are peanuts for birds just a ploy by the peanut marketing board - or is there a feathered thing out there that actually does like them?

Some birds that dont: Magpie, Jackdaw, Rook, Goldfinch, Chaffinch, Spotted Woodpecker, Blackbird, Robin, Starling, Thrush, Sparrow, Wren, Blue Tit, Great Tit, Dove, Wood Pidgeon...

Actually all the birds with the exception of Thrush and Rook will take Peanuts.



I t all depends on what other foods are available to them.!



The last few days I have found that the peanuts have not been taken because I have start to put out Sunflower kernels

and the birds know whats best.they go for them first.

We have 2 peanut feeders out 24 7 and have seen gt spotted woodpeckers, Nut hatch, blue *its, great *its, coal *its, all feeding every day.

woodpeckers nuthatches bluetits coaltits jackdaws jays longtailed **** all eat peanuts in the spring when they are nesting they will crush them as to feed them whole to thier young would result in the youngsters choking,,,,all the above birds eat them in my orchard every day,,just keep watching im sure you will change your mind soon good luck,,,,,,,,,,
